I recently installed IRIXSamples on 2 SGI's:

Usually the first one is used for tests, trying out and Dvt and the second one is used among others of its kind to run CAD and simulation software.

1-Indigo2 XZ Extreme R4000 200MHz IRIX 6.5.5 Java2 JDK 1.2.2, 200Mb Virtual swap , 428Mb physical swap ,128Mb RAM.

2-Octane R12000 300MHz IRIX 6.5.5 Java2 JDK 1.2.2 39Mb Virtual swap , 900Mb physical swap , 1Gb RAM.

I noticed:

- Not much of a difference between the 2 Workstations in perf.

- The graphic regeneration for panels ( panel area damage restoring ) and entities manipulations were quite slow compared to many CAD/UNIX Workstations softwares that I would be kind not to mention.

- Not fast enough in that state to be used in a productive environment.

I believe that could be improved significantly, thinking that system's setups are not fit to get the best of Java.
